Cost of Living in Palm Springs, United States

Quick answer: As of 2026, living in Palm Springs costs approximately $2,702 per month for one person, with city-centre one-bedroom rent averaging $1,905. Actual costs vary with lifestyle, neighborhood, and exchange rates.

Palm Springs is a city in United States, where a single person can expect to spend about $2,702 per month including rent, food, and local transport. A one-bedroom apartment in the city centre averages $1,905 per month, or $1,480 outside the centre. Internet is fast at around 167 Mbps median download speed. On safety, Palm Springs scores 55/100 — moderately safe for residents and visitors. Expect summer highs near 110°F and winter highs around 60°F, with roughly 348 sunny days a year.

Palm Springs FAQ

How much does it cost to live in Palm Springs?

A single person should budget around $2,702 per month in Palm Springs, covering rent, groceries, transport, and basic lifestyle costs. A family of four typically needs about $4,379 per month.

How much is rent in Palm Springs?

A one-bedroom apartment in central Palm Springs averages $1,905 per month, dropping to about $1,480 outside the centre. A three-bedroom in the centre runs about $3,840.

Is Palm Springs safe?

Palm Springs scores 55/100 on safety, which is moderately safe. Tourist safety is rated 78/100.

How fast is the internet in Palm Springs?

Median download speeds in Palm Springs are around 167 Mbps — fast for remote work and video calls. There are roughly 22 coworking spaces in the city.

What is the weather like in Palm Springs?

Palm Springs sees summer highs around 110°F and winter highs near 60°F, with about 348 sunny days and 23 rainy days per year.
